Exciting Updates Coming to Disneyland Resort Hotels
Disneyland Resort is adding new experiences to its hotels, offering guests even more magical, memorable, and uniquely Disney stays. From reimagined dining spaces to refreshed accommodations, here's a look at what’s on the horizon.
Napa Rose’s Stunning Redesign
The award-winning Napa Rose is undergoing a transformation to elevate its dining experience. Celebrating California’s rich winemaking history and Craftsman design, the revamped space will feature:
- Reclaimed French oak floors and columns inspired by wine barrels.
- Handcrafted metal details, deep cabernet hues, and leather accents.
- A chandelier reminiscent of California grapevines.
The restaurant will expand its exhibition kitchen counters, allowing guests to watch the chefs in action. Its enhanced outdoor patio will include more seating and two fireplaces for cozy al fresco dining.
Set to reopen in fall 2025 after a temporary closure this spring, Napa Rose will debut a refreshed menu while keeping fan favorites like the Smiling Tiger Salad. Its renowned wine collection of over 1,500 labels will remain a highlight.
Two New Concierge Lounges to Debut
Disneyland Hotel and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a are set to welcome two all-new concierge lounges.
High Key Club at Disneyland Hotel
Opening summer 2025, this mid-century modern-inspired lounge celebrates the music and sounds of Disneyland circa 1955. Featuring artifacts, a custom soundtrack, and panoramic views, High Key Club offers concierge-level guests the perfect spot to enjoy Disneyland fireworks and music on select nights.
New Lounge at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a
This upcoming two-story lounge will continue the hotel’s Craftsman theme, drawing inspiration from California’s giant sequoias. Located on the 5th and 6th floors, the space will include:
- A forest-inspired design with handcrafted tile murals and branching wrought iron details.
- Skylights that bathe the lounge in natural light and a golden glow at sunset.
- A curved staircase and stained-glass door connecting its two levels.
The lounge is expected to open in 2026, offering concierge guests a serene retreat filled with luxurious touches.
Refreshed Guest Rooms at Disney’s Grand Californian
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a will update all guest rooms and Disney Vacation Club Villas. New designs will complement the hotel’s Arts & Crafts aesthetic with:
- Bold colors in carpets, upholstery, and bedding inspired by California wildflowers.
- Original artwork commissioned from local plein air painters.
Pixar Place Hotel: Themed Signature Suites
This summer, Pixar Place Hotel will introduce two premium themed suites:
Coco Suite
Designed with Oaxacan-inspired architecture, the Coco Suite will feature:
- Handcrafted wooden furniture and terracotta tiles.
- Mexican artisan décor, including quilted and woven pieces.
- A fireplace and family mementos inspired by the Rivera family hacienda.

The Incredibles Suite
Channeling mid-century “spy-fi” vibes, the Incredibles Suite includes:
- A primary bedroom for the Parr parents and an adjoining Edna Mode-themed room.
- Fun interactive features like a spy phone, hidden messages, and secret doors.
These suites join the hotel’s variety of room options, from standard rooms to spacious multi-bedroom suites.
Exclusive Perks for Disneyland Resort Hotel Guests
Guests staying at any Disneyland Resort hotel can enjoy magical benefits, including:
- Early Entry, allowing access to select attractions 30 minutes before the general public.
- Preferred access to a limited number of hotel restaurant reservations.
- Unique hotel activities and close proximity to Disneyland Resort theme parks.
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a and Pixar Place Hotel also offer direct entrances to Disney California Adventure Park for added convenience.
